Ugx. 807,799,000
View detail
Ugx. 912,700,000
Ugx. 829,550,000
Ugx. 456,929,000
Ugx. 805,756,000
Ugx. 473,605,000
Ugx. 386,744,000
Ugx. 413,679,000
Ugx. 322,182,000
Ugx. 346,560,000
Ugx. 368,868,000
Ugx. 362,456,000